Lokesh Kanagaraj and Rajinikanth to team up?

Director Mysskin recently revealed that Rajinikanth will be collaborating with Lokesh Kanagaraj for film

While Lokesh Kanagaraj is currently shooting Leo with actor Vijay, speculations are rife that the filmmaker will be collaborating with actor Rajinikanth for the latter's 171st film. However, an official announcement on the film is yet to be made. 

In a recent interview with an online media, director Mysskin revealed that Lokesh will be teaming up with Rajinikanth. It is to be noted that Mysskin is currently acting in Leo. Mentioning that Lokesh's films are mostly commercial thrillers, he added, "The ideas he pitches, his casting, everything makes his film a hit. While his previous film, Vikram, was a blockbuster, as a director I would say that he is an interesting filmmaker. He will be working with Rajinikanth and it's a proud moment. I think this will mark Rajinikanth's final film. However, it is not confirmed officially." Mysskin also revealed that Rajinikanth invited Lokesh to work with him

Meanwhile, Rajinikanth is currently working in Jailer and is scheduled to make a special appearance in his daughter Aishwarya Rajinikanth's directorial Lal Salaam.

On the other hand, Lokesh is busy shooting for Leo, which also stars Trisha, Arjun, and Sanjay Dutt among others.
